Output 31e81c2ad7009d20511032e3d3583bb0a6fcd1006224c27927768b7efd84cc46:0

value
11713140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8217e9d820505a8f0a8ec289b5b49d47f67454 OP_EQUAL
address
3Jskof33xPTzQsQTASPpMkUsMtqhDNtMr7
transaction
31e81c2ad7009d20511032e3d3583bb0a6fcd1006224c27927768b7efd84cc46